メインコンテンツまでスキップ

3) Security365 会社別ビルトインプロファイルの照会

Security365 会社別ビルトインプロファイルの照会

  • TENANT_APP_ID, TENANT_APP_SECRET項目を除外

API

MethodURL
GET/builtInProfile/internal/info

Request Header

NameRequiredDescription
Authorizationrequiredユーザー認証手段、JWT値
Authorization: Bearer {JWT}

[顧客会社業務システム用]
JWT値はSKMSサービスのJWT(トークン)発行APIを通じて発行されます。

[Security365 サービス用]
JWT値は認証/認可サービスを通じて発行される。
- JWTの後に companyId が追加されています。
- JWT@@SKMS_SEPARATOR@@COMPANYID形式で入力されます
- @@SKMS_SEPARATOR@@ 区切り文字でパースして使用

Response

NameTypeDescription
codeint成功の有無 (成功:0)
dataJsonArrayビルトインプロファイルの一覧
   keystringアトリビュート名
   valuestringアトリビュート値
   descstringアトリビュートの詳細
   usestringアトリビュートの使用有無
   additionalInformationstringアトリビュートの説明

Examples

Response

  • ビルトインプロファイルの取得に成功しました
{
"code": 0,
"data": [
{
"key": "KEY_VAULT_OPTION",
"value": "E",
"use": true
},
{
"key": "KEY_UPDATE_TIME",
"value": "1747062001170|809",
"use": true,
"addInfo": "키 정보 최종 업데이트 시간"
},
...(생략)
]
}
  • トークン検証失敗
{
"code": 40101,
"message": "Invalid token",
"detail": "invalid_token"
}
  • 内部サービスの失敗
{
"code": 50001,
"message": "An unexpected error has occurred in the internal system"
}